Luis Filipe Nassif commented on TIKA-93:
----------------------------------------
We could populate metadata using existing image parsers. If ocr is not enabled,
this parser could only populate image metadata. So we could list this parser in
services/org.apache.tika.parser.Parser list without changing default image
parsing.

> I don't know of any decent open source pure Java OCR libraries, but there are
> command line OCR tools like Tesseract
> (http://code.google.com/p/tesseract-ocr/) that could be invoked by Tika to
> extract text content (where available) from image files.
